What is a filler piece and do I need one?

A filler piece fills the space between the cabinet and the wall and is cut from a cover panel.

Filler pieces are necessary because you can't install a cabinet right up close to the wall. If you don't mount a filler piece, there's a risk that you won't be able to open your cabinet door or drawers fully.
